Why & when do I need to remove my wisdom teeth?

Wisdom teeth, also known as third molars, are the last set of molars that typically emerge in your late teens or early twenties. While some people have no issues with their wisdom teeth, many experience pain, infections, and other dental problems that necessitate their removal. Why Do Wisdom Teeth Need to Be Removed?

  • Impacted Wisdom Teeth: When wisdom teeth do not have enough space to emerge properly, they become impacted, causing pain, swelling, and infections.
  • Overcrowding: Wisdom teeth can cause misalignment in your existing teeth by pushing against them, potentially undoing orthodontic treatment.
  • Gum Infections and Cavities: Due to their position, wisdom teeth are harder to clean, leading to cavities, gum infections, and bad breath.
  • Cysts and Jaw Damage: Sometimes, cysts may form around impacted wisdom teeth, damaging surrounding teeth and jawbone.
  • Sinus Issues: The roots of upper wisdom teeth can extend close to the sinus cavity, leading to sinus pain, pressure, and congestion.

When Should You Remove Your Wisdom Teeth?

  • Before They Cause Pain: Dentists often recommend removing wisdom teeth before severe problems arise to prevent infections and complications.
  • During Late Teens or Early Twenties: Wisdom teeth roots are not fully developed during this period, making extraction easier and recovery faster.

  • If You Have Persistent Pain: Continuous pain, swelling, or infections indicate that wisdom teeth removal is necessary.

The Wisdom Teeth Removal Process

  2. Local or General Anesthesia: Your dentist will administer anesthesia to ensure a pain-free experience.
  3. Extraction Procedure: A small incision is made, the tooth is removed, and stitches are placed if necessary.
  4. Recovery and Aftercare:
    • Apply an ice pack to reduce swelling.
    • Avoid hard or spicy foods for a few days.
    • Keep the area clean and follow prescribed medications.
